Conditions

Sepsis

Interventions

Experimental group:Prepare Chaiqin Chengqi decoction and take 80ml Q6h orally or gastric tube infusion. The temperature of the drug is maintained at 32-40 ?. Medication will be suspended at AGI level
Control group:Prepare a placebo and inject 80ml Q6h orally or through a gastric tube. The temperature of the drug is maintained at 32-40 ?. Medication will be suspended at AGI level 4. For patients wi

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: (1) Patients who meet the diagnostic criteria for sepsis, according to the 2016 3.0 sepsis diagnostic criteria (Singer et al., 2016), have a Sequential Organ Failure Assessment Score (SOFA) of = 2 points. (2) Simultaneously present with acute gastrointestinal injury (diagnosis and grading based on the guidelines developed by the ESICM Abdominal Issues Working Group). (3) Age 18 and above, regardless of gender. (4) Willing to participate in the experiment and sign an informed consent form.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: (1) patients with malignancy. (2) Pregnant and lactating patients. (3) Gastrointestinal bleeding, mechanical intestinal obstruction, gastrointestinal necrosis, perforation. (4) Patients with varying degrees of mental disorders or mental illnesses. (5) Individuals with allergies to traditional Chinese medicine or other adverse reactions to traditional Chinese medicine.(6) Emergency surgical patients are required immediately upon admission.

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
AGI classification;intra-abdominal pressure;IAP;Sepsis score (SOFA);APACHE? score ;mortality;Start time of enteral nutrition;

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
Parenteral nutrition time;Antibiotic usage time;Anal exhaust time;Anal defecation time;Total hospitalization time;ICU stay time;white blood cell count;C-reactive protein;Procalcitonin;interleukin-6;
